Eligibility Criteria
Inclusion Criteria
- •1\. Aged 40–80 years.
- •2\. Clinical diagnosis of type 2 diabetes
- •\[controlled diabetes through diet or medication (excluding insulin)].
- •3\. Weight \<180kg
- •4\. Have given signed informed consent to participate in the study.
Exclusion Criteria
- •1\.Age \<40 years or \> 80 years.
- •2\.Patients using insulin to control blood sugar levels.
- •3\.Weight \>180kg
- •4\.Pulmonary hypertension.
- •5\.Atrial fibrillation.
- •6\.Cardiovascular disease including coronary artery disease, heart valve disease or heart failure.
- •7\.Critical limb ischemia including peripheral artery disease or previous revascularisation or other surgical treatment for peripheral artery disease.
- •8\.History of malignancy within past 5 years (except for non\-melanoma skin cancers).
- •9\.Identification of any medical condition requiring immediate therapeutic intervention.
- •10\.Uncontrolled hypertension (resting brachial blood pressure \=160/100 mmHg).
